Barn Painting Service in Longmont, CO
Barn painting services involve applying protective and decorative coatings to barn exteriors, including walls, doors, and trim. These projects typically cover large wooden or metal surfaces that require weather-resistant finishes to preserve the structure and enhance its appearance. Property owners often seek barn painting for ongoing maintenance, renovation, or to improve the overall look of their rural or farm properties.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to understand the condition of the existing surfaces, the type of paint or coating desired, and any specific preparations needed to ensure a smooth and durable finish.
Homeowners and property owners usually want to know about the scope of work, including surface preparation, paint options, and the extent of repairs needed prior to painting.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project meets expectations and maintains the structural integrity of the barn. It’s also important to consider the weather conditions and timing, as outdoor painting projects are best scheduled during suitable seasons to achieve the best results and longevity of the coating.

Common Barn Painting Service Jobs
Barn exteriors - refreshing and protecting the outer surfaces of barns and farm structures.
Wood surfaces - enhancing the appearance and durability of barn siding and trim.
Metal surfaces - applying protective coatings to metal barn components to prevent rust.
Interior barn walls - updating interior surfaces to improve cleanliness and aesthetics.
Fence painting - maintaining and beautifying barnyard fencing for added curb appeal.
Weatherproofing - applying finishes that help barns withstand the elements and extend lifespan.
Barn Painting Service Questions
What types of barns can be painted? Barn painting services typically cover various types including pole barns, timber frame barns, and historic structures, ensuring proper preparation and finish for each style.
What should property owners consider before painting a barn? It's important to assess the barn’s surface condition, choose appropriate paint types, and plan for necessary surface preparation to achieve a durable finish.
Are special paints needed for barn exteriors? Yes, exterior paints designed for wood or metal surfaces are recommended to withstand weather conditions and provide long-lasting protection.
What areas of a barn are usually painted? Commonly painted areas include siding, doors, trim, and any exposed structural elements to enhance appearance and protect against the elements.
